HelenOS sources
reserve_try_alloc 42 kernel/generic/include/mm/reserve.h extern bool reserve_try_alloc(size_t);
reserve_try_alloc 88 kernel/generic/src/mm/backend_anon.c return reserve_try_alloc(area->pages);
reserve_try_alloc 97 kernel/generic/src/mm/backend_anon.c return reserve_try_alloc(new_pages - area->pages);
reserve_try_alloc 243 kernel/generic/src/mm/backend_anon.c if (!reserve_try_alloc(1)) {
reserve_try_alloc 120 kernel/generic/src/mm/backend_elf.c return reserve_try_alloc(area->pages - nonanon_pages);
reserve_try_alloc 130 kernel/generic/src/mm/backend_elf.c return reserve_try_alloc(new_pages - area->pages);
reserve_try_alloc 132 kernel/generic/src/mm/backend_elf.c return reserve_try_alloc(new_pages - nonanon_pages);
HelenOS homepage, sources at GitHub